Michell Hodge, 47, passed away at Tennova Hospital January 13, 2022. She graduated from Murray County High School in the class of 1992. She enjoyed hiking and camping with her children, and had a passion for art. She created an art exhibition for the Cleveland Public Library.
She is survived by her husband, Jeff Hodge; her son, Michael Hodge; her two daughters, Kimberly Hodge and Hannah Abgail Hodge; her mother, Virginia Pierce; her father, George Piercel her half-sisters, Sherrian Finneran, Helen Costner, Sandy Costner and Kathy Pierce; and her girlfriend, Andi Townsend.
The family will receive friends at the Companion Funeral Home at 2414 Georgetown Road in Cleveland on Thursday, Jan. 20 from 4-8 p.m. A service celebrating her life is planned for the following day, Friday, Jan. 21 at 11 a.m. at the Tennga Baptist Church, 257 Tennga Gregory Road, Tennga, Ga. 30751, with the Reverend Ben Busie officiating. Burial will be held at the Tennga Baptist Church Cemetery.
